Understanding TPS Mastery

What is TPS?

TPS, or Transactions Per Second, is a measure of how many transactions a system can handle in one second. It's a critical metric for evaluating the performance and scalability of any system, particularly in high-traffic environments like e-commerce platforms or financial services.

The Importance of TPS

In today's digital age, where milliseconds can mean the difference between success and failure, TPS mastery is more than just a technical achievement—it's a competitive advantage. Systems with high TPS can handle more users, process more transactions, and maintain lower latency, all of which contribute to a better user experience and higher revenue.

1. System Architecture

Min emphasizes the importance of a robust and scalable system architecture. He often uses a microservices architecture, which allows for independent scaling of different components, thus improving overall system performance.

2. Load Balancing

Efficient load balancing is crucial for maintaining high TPS. Min employs advanced load balancing techniques to distribute traffic evenly across servers, preventing any single server from becoming a bottleneck.

3. Caching

Caching is another cornerstone of Min's approach. By storing frequently accessed data in memory, he reduces the need to fetch data from slower storage systems, significantly improving response times.

4. Database Optimization

Min's deep understanding of databases allows him to optimize queries, indexes, and data structures for maximum performance. He also employs read replicas and sharding to distribute the load and improve read performance.
